The perimeter of a rectangular painting is 312 centimeters. If the width of the painting is 64 centimeters, what is its length?

Perimeter= 2L + 2W
312 cm= 2L + 2(64)
312= 2L + 128
subtract 128 from both sides
184= 2L
divide both sides by 2
92 cm= L

ANSWER: The length is 92cm.
